Bo, just to refresh our memory, what should the toe be set at and how do we measure it?
Seem like the cones should be set 1/16th in or so if I remember. turning in should be 1/8 for single tie bar and 1/16 or dead even with a dual tie bar regardless. turning in= toe out, and turning out= toe in. center of bulett and center of prop shaft. you can use the pitot hole just above the the bulett if your running stock lowers |
